>>>>> On Tue, 03 Sep 2002 17:16:08 -0400, George Gensure <werkt@csh.rit.edu> said:
werkt> I have no idea why this kernel is able to mount nfs partitions
werkt> in the install, but not at boot time.

On install, rootfs is ramdisk and you will be prompted network
parameters by the installer.  On diskless boot, kernel ip pnp will be
used to configure network.  So "ip=" and "nfsroot=" options may be
required on diskless boot.  But I do not know how to specify these
options on Indy boot loader.
